    Shouldn't use a towel - it will stay wet and make the kitty cold. Use STRAW, not hay to keep the kitty warm and toasty.     We had a stray live on or front porch for a few years. We called him PorchCat. We lined a large plastic tote with towels, cut a cat sized door and flipped it upside down. He loved it through the winters. We used more towels for bedding but straw would've worked just as well.
